Training formats

  • Campus: in-person instruction with labs (when applicable)
  • Hybrid: a mix of online coursework and required in-person sessions
  • Online: some programs offer online coursework; hands-on components may still be required

Typical timelines

CredentialCommon RangeNotes
Certificate / DiplomaMonthsOften the fastest route; availability varies by school
Associate Degree~2 yearsMay include general education and broader coursework

What to compare

  • Program outcomes: what the curriculum covers and what it does not cover
  • Hands-on training: labs, externships, clinicals, or shop time (when applicable)
  • Schedule: start dates, evening/weekend options, part-time availability
  • Total cost: tuition, fees, books, tools, and uniforms (confirm with the school)
  • Requirements: prerequisites, background checks, immunizations, or driving record rules (if applicable)
  • Accreditation and approvals: what matters for your credential or licensing path
  • Exam/licensing prep: preparation and required hours (varies by state)

Questions to ask schools

  • Which credential do students earn, and what are the graduation requirements?
  • What is the weekly schedule and the expected time commitment?
  • What equipment, tools, or uniforms are required, and what do they cost?
  • Does the program prepare students for required exams or supervised hours (if applicable)?
  • Are transfer credits accepted, and are there prerequisites?
